## Build Provenance: Linkweave Deep-Link Router

All release builds of the Linkweave routing module for the Pellenor mobile app are produced on hermetic builders and signed before distribution. Route-table changes are reviewed by the Nocturne platform team, and each artifact records its source revision and builder identity. Reviewers should confirm the manifest hash matches the registry entry. The provenance token for the current build follows.

session token of yahof-bajeg = htk9_0d43d44ed

Ticket #— Floor 9 Opening Prep, Brindlemoor House

Hi facilities folks, Floor 9 opens to staff next Monday and we need a few things squared away before then. Lift access is live, but the two side doors by the kitchenette are still on the old lock config — please reprogram them before Friday. Also, signage for the quiet rooms hasn't arrived, so pop up the temporary printed ones for now. Until the badge readers sync, the interim door code for Floor 9 is below.

door code, bajop-bajog: bdg-DSWAC-43621

## Authentication

The Tariffly rate-lookup cache serves jurisdiction tax rates with a 24-hour TTL. Plugin authors should note that all cache reads require a signed request; unsigned calls are rejected with a 401 and are never served stale data. Rate writes are restricted to the internal sync daemon, so plugins are read-only by design. For local development against the staging cache, authenticate with the key below.

gateway credential: kto23_LX9A4ys6i4nzHtpOLNLodKK

## Onboarding: SquelchBot

SquelchBot dedupes on-call alerts across the Pell and Varro clusters. Review focus: hashing logic in `fingerprint.go` and the suppression window config. All merges to main require a signed commit; CI rejects anything else. Tests must pass under the replay harness before approval. Builds are verified against the team's release key, included below for reference.

deploy key for bawig-tajop: bky9_PQ3GVoQw1